CANTON - St. Lawrence University will hold its Commencement ceremony on Sunday, May 23, at 10 a.m. on the Owen D. Young Library Quadrangle. The ceremony will be in Leithead Fieldhouse in the event of inclement weather.

Three honorary degrees and a North Country Citation will be awarded at Commencement. All four honored guests will speak. Diane DiPrima, poet and playwright of the "Beat" generation; Adirondack photographer Nathan Farb; and The Honorable John Fraser, until recently Canada's Ambassador for the Environment, will all receive honorary degrees. U. S. Representative John M. McHugh (R-Pierrepont Manor) will receive the 1999 North Country Citation.

DiPrima is a poet, essayist, dramatist, editor, teacher and publisher. In "The Beats," George Butterick wrote, "Among women of her generation, Diane DiPrima is the writer who by her life and work most embodies the definable patterns of the Beat Generation." Her "Selected Poems" was published in 1975; her autobiography, "Memoirs of a Beatnik," was published in 1998.

Farb is widely recognized as one of the premier outdoor photographers working today, and the Adirondacks have been one of the principal subjects of his photographs. His work appears regularly in The New York Times Magazine, National Geographic, Adirondack Life and Conde Nast Traveler, among other publications.

Former Speaker of the House of Commons in Canada, Fraser was appointed Ambassador for the Environment in 1994 and was awarded the Order of Canada in 1995. He is affiliated with many international environmental organizations, including the World Wildlife Fund Canada Nature of Tomorrow Campaign, the Biosphere Program, the Advisory Committee on Protection of the Sea and the International Institute for Sustainable Development. In 1981, he was the keynote speaker for the St. Lawrence University Canada-U.S. Acid Rain Seminar.

McHugh is serving his third term in the House of Representatives from the 24th Congressional District, which includes all of Clinton, Hamilton, Franklin, Fulton, Lewis, Jefferson, St. Lawrence and Oswego Counties in New York state, as well as parts of Herkimer and Essex Counties. He is a member of the Committees on National Security, Government Reform and Oversight and International Relations. St. Lawrence annually awards the North Country Citation to individuals from the region who, through their professional and volunteer endeavors, have improved the quality of life in the North Country.
